New Orleans after Hurricane Katrina: Towing flooded out automobiles from the neutral ground of Napoleon Avenue near Freret Street, Uptown. Many people parked their automobiles on raised neutral grounds (medians) in unsucessful hopes of saving them from rising flood waters. Note lines from long standing flood water visible on car just below door handles. Flood lines also visible on houses in background, particularly clearly on white pillars of house at right.
